Design of Terminal State Evaluation System for Distribution Network Automation with Distributed Power Sources
As an important component of power system management,distribution network automation aims to improve the reliability,stability,and economy of the power grid.After the introduction of distributed power sources,distribution network automation terminals face new challenges,such as real-time monitoring and evaluation of system status,ensuring power supply safety and quality,etc.This article provides a detailed analysis of the design requirements for a state evaluation system in a distribution network automation system that includes distributed power sources,including requirements for data accuracy,real-time performance,and system flexibility.In the architecture design section of the state evaluation system,a comprehensive system architecture utilizing key technologies such as data fusion and fuzzy logic is proposed,and the application of these technologies in state evaluation is discussed in detail.
